Using Templates for Documentation Driven API Design

As an API provider it's important to consider how consumers interact with your API. While most people leave this task to the very end, API design should, in fact, begin with clear and concise documentation. This practice is often called "Documentation Driven Design" or "Documentation Driven Development" and is followed by many practitioners around the world.